Find LCM of 561,693,386,887,154 with Prime Factorization
2 | 561, 693, 386, 887, 154 |
3 | 561, 693, 193, 887, 77 |
7 | 187, 231, 193, 887, 77 |
11 | 187, 33, 193, 887, 11 |
17, 3, 193, 887, 1 |
Multiply the prime numbers at the bottom and the left side.
2 x 3 x 7 x 11 x 17 x 3 x 193 x 887 x 1 = 4033602342
Therefore, the lowest common multiple of 561,693,386,887,154 is 4033602342.
